Breaded stuffed meatloaf recipe

Time: 1 hour

Performance: 6 servings

Difficulty: easy

Ingredients:

  • 1 grated onion
  • 2 tablespoons cream of onion powder
  • 1 egg
  • 2 tablespoons of wheat flour
  • Salt, oregano and chopped green chilli to taste
  • 2 cups grated mozzarella
  • 1 cup grated ham
  • Wheat flour for breading
  • Fry oil
  • Grated mozzarella and parmesan for sprinkling

Preparation method:

  1. In a bowl, mix the meat, onion, onion cream, egg, flour, salt, oregano and green pepper until a smooth mixture forms.
  2. Open portions of dough between your hands, divide the mozzarella and ham between them and close again forming slightly flattened discs.
  3. Dredge them in wheat flour and fry them, little by little, in boiling oil until golden. Drain on absorbent paper.
  4. In a refractory container, add a little tomato sauce and place the polpetones on top.
  5. Season with more sauce, sprinkle with mozzarella, parmesan and bake in a medium preheated oven for 10 minutes.
  6. Remove from the oven and then serve your stuffed breaded meatloaf.
